I have just set up a couple of gmail accounts and added them to thunderbird, i did this yesterday and could recieve mail fine. Today i have tried to get my new messages and a pop up appears asking for me to "enter password for [email="xxxxx@googlemail.com"]xxxxx@googlemail.com[/email] on pop.googlemail.com" ?
I have tried the passwords which i have used when setting up the google accounts, but no luck.
Anyone know where i am going wrong? Where is the password option for individual accounts in Thunderbird?
Thanks for any help:)

If I understand you right, you need in Thunderbird:
Tools, Options, Advanced, Click + on saved passwords, View Saved Passwords, show passwords, click yes then you will see all the entered passwords on the right hand side (including the wrong ones)
The problem is if you enter a wrong password TB always sends it to the server so you need to remove all the passwords for gmail and then it will ask for a password when you connect, this time put in the correct one.0 -

In the View Saved Passwords screen, select the site entry for gmail and click on Remove, then Close and OK. When you next connect to gmail, you should get asked for the password.0
